Title: Cron drift on Pellwater nightly reconciliation. Over the past three weeks the reconciliation job has started progressively later, now fourteen minutes past its slot. Suspected cause is the upstream Brassfield scheduler rebalancing after the node pool shrink; each rebalance shifts lease acquisition slightly. Blocking the Thursday cut until we confirm the drift does not push past the ledger lock window. The trace token from the latest drifted run follows.

build token for kagaf-hahof: htk14_9d3d4d26d7d8de

Subject: Quickstore 4.2 — bloom filter now fronts the KV layer

Plugin authors: starting with this release, Quickstore places a bloom filter ahead of the key-value store. Negative lookups return faster; false positives fall through safely. No API changes are required on your side. Verify your plugin against the staging build referenced below.

session token of fahif-tadup = htk3_9c7

Subject: Key rotation — LoadForge checkout tests

Hi,

Ahead of Friday's release, we rotated the credential that LoadForge uses to drive synthetic traffic through the CartPilot checkout flow. The old key stops working at 18:00 tomorrow, so please update the release pipeline's environment config before then; otherwise the pre-release load run will fail at the payment step and block sign-off. For the staging LoadForge orchestrator, use the newly issued key below.

gateway credential: kto7_GoY89Me

Ticket: Nightly inventory reconciliation job (StockMender) double-counts transfers between the Larkwood and Penhale depots when a shipment spans midnight. Net variance report shows phantom surplus of affected SKUs. Fix lands in the hotfix branch; needs cherry-pick before Friday's cut. Verified against replayed ledger data, variance now zero. Release manager: confirm against the trace token below before signing off.

build token for yajef-kagef: htk14_cbbee23b70220b

Quarterly Planning Note — Supplier Renewal

The Ostermark Components contract expires at the end of Q3. Renewal terms include a 4% unit cost increase offset by extended payment terms of net-60. Finance should model both renewal and the alternative bid from Corvel Materials before the planning review. Accruals stay on the current schedule. One item requires strict discretion.

management briefing: Project Ulavan slips by two quarters because of the staffing delay.